Re: Graphic designer
I'm pretty sure that as an international student, you don't have a GPA that gets reported to American lae schools - your undergraduate performance gets graded on a non-numerical scale (I think the highest is "superior"), and is therefore less valuable to schools. Your LSAT will carry more weight.
